INGREDIENTS (Nutrition)

  • 1 (8 ounce) package egg noodles
  • 3/4 cup low-fat mayonnaise
  • 1 teaspoon Worcestershire sauce
  • 3 tablespoons ketchup
  • 1 chopped onions
  • 1 large green bell pepper, chopped
  • 1 1/2 cups cooked crabmeat
  • 1 (4 ounce) can small shrimp, drained
  • 1 cup diced celery
  • salt and pepper to taste
  • 1/4 cup dry bread crumbs

DIRECTIONS

  1.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C).
  2. In a large pot of salted boiling water, cook pasta until al dente. Drain, and transfer to a large bowl.
  3. Add mayonnaise, Worcestershire sauce, ketchup, and onion to the noodles; mix well. Stir in green pepper, crab, shrimp and celery. Salt and pepper to taste. Spoon mixture into an 8x8 inch casserole dish. Sprinkle bread crumbs to taste over the casserole.
  4. Bake 35 minutes in the preheated oven, until brown and bubbly.
